What is a gift card?
Also known as brand vouchers, gift vouchers and brand cards, gift cards are a digital mode of payment which carries a amount along with a pin / card no. You can buy these gift cards and use them to pay on 300+ brand online and offline as well.
Why should I use a gift card?
Gift cards help you get great value on your purchase with a brand. They simplify giving, help with budgeting, and are easily sent across distances, ensuring your thoughtful gesture brings joy and value.
How to use a gift card?
To use a gift card, simply present it at the time of purchase in-store or enter the card’s unique code at checkout when shopping online. The amount of your purchase will be deducted from the card's balance.

The Charm of Gold Chain Designs

Gold chains are not just pieces of jewellery; they are expressions of style, statements of elegance, and symbols of status. Let's explore some popular gold chain designs that have captured the hearts of ladies across the globe.

Gold Chain Designs for Ladies

From the traditional 'mango mala' to the trendy 'infinity chain', gold chain designs for ladies are as diverse as they are beautiful. Here are a few popular designs:

  • Box Chain: Characterised by square links that form a continuous, smooth chain, the box chain is a classic design that exudes understated elegance.
  • Rope Chain: Resembling a twisted rope, this chain design is known for its durability and versatility. It can be worn alone or with a pendant for added charm.
  • Figaro Chain: Originating from Italy, the Figaro chain features a pattern of alternating small and large links. It's a popular choice for its unique and stylish design.

Modern Gold Necklace Designs

Modern gold necklace designs blend traditional charm with contemporary style. They are perfect for the modern woman who loves to keep her style chic yet rooted in tradition. Some popular designs include:

  • Geometric Designs: These feature shapes like circles, squares, and triangles for a modern and edgy look.
  • Lariat Necklaces: These are long, open-ended necklaces that can be tied or looped in various ways, offering versatility and style.
  • Bar Necklaces: These feature a horizontal bar pendant, often engraved with names or initials, making them a popular choice for personalised jewellery.

Latest Gold Necklace Designs

Keeping up with the latest trends in gold necklace designs can be exciting. From layered necklaces to choker styles, the world of gold jewellery is always evolving. Here are some of the latest trends:

  • Layered Necklaces: This involves wearing multiple chains of varying lengths together for a trendy, boho-chic look.
  • Choker Styles: A throwback to the 90s, choker-style gold necklaces are back in vogue. They look great with both western and traditional outfits.
  • Pendant Necklaces: These feature a chain with a standout pendant. The pendant could be anything from a geometric shape to a delicate charm or a bold statement piece.

Traditional Gold Choker Designs

Traditional gold chokers are a timeless classic. They sit snugly around the neck and are often adorned with intricate designs and gemstones. Here are some popular designs:

  • Swirled Link Choker: This design features a series of gold links arranged in a swirling pattern, giving the choker a dynamic and flowing look.
  • South Indian CZ Necklace: This choker design is inspired by South Indian jewellery and features cubic zirconia stones set in a gold-tone necklace. It often includes emerald and ruby stones arranged in a floral pattern.
  • Gold-Plated Hammered Choker: This minimalist design features a gold-plated choker with a hammered finish, giving it a unique texture and shine.
  • Traditional Antique Gold Plated Choker: This design takes inspiration from antique jewellery styles, featuring intricate patterns and designs plated in gold for a vintage look.

The Significance of Wearing Gold

Gold is not just a precious metal; it's a symbol of prosperity, luck, and wealth in many cultures, especially in India. But why is wearing gold considered significant? Let's find out:

  • Symbol of Wealth: Gold has been a symbol of wealth and prosperity for centuries. Wearing gold jewellery is often seen as a sign of financial stability and success.
  • Good Luck Charm: In many cultures, gold is considered to bring good luck. It's often worn during important events and celebrations to attract positivity and fortune.
  • Health Benefits: Believe it or not, gold is said to have certain health benefits. It's believed to improve blood circulation and regulate body temperature. However, these claims are mostly based on traditional beliefs and lack scientific evidence.

Matching Necklaces with V-Neck Dresses

V-neck dresses are a classic choice that flatters almost every body type. But when it comes to accessorising them, the trick is to choose a necklace that follows the V shape. Here are some tips:

  • Choker Length Necklaces: If you're going for a short necklace, a choker-length necklace is a good choice. It opens up the neckline and draws attention to your face.
  • Pendant Necklaces: A pendant necklace that falls into the V of the dress can also complement a V-neck dress beautifully. It creates a balanced look and adds a touch of elegance.
  • Layered Necklaces: If you're feeling adventurous, try layering a couple of necklaces of different lengths. Just make sure that one of them aligns with the V shape of the dress.

Matching Jewelry Color to Outfit

Matching the colour of your jewellery to your outfit can create a cohesive and stylish look. Here are some tips:

  • Complementary Colours: Complementary colours are opposite each other on the colour wheel and can create a vibrant look when paired together. For instance, if you're wearing a red dress, green jewellery can make your outfit pop.
  • Monochromatic Colours: Monochromatic colours are different shades, tones, and tints of a single colour. For instance, if you're wearing a light blue dress, you can pair it with dark blue jewellery.
  • Analogous Colours: Analogous colours are next to each other on the colour wheel. They match well and can create a serene and comfortable design. For example, you can pair a yellow dress with green jewellery.
